Taro Logo

Software Engineer, Early Career, Start 2025

A global technology company that develops innovative products and services used by billions of users worldwide.
Backend
Entry-Level Software Engineer
In-Person
5,000+ Employees
Enterprise SaaS · AI
This job posting is no longer active. 😔

Job Description

Google is seeking early-career Software Engineers to join their Platforms and Ecosystems product area, working on computing software platforms across desktop, mobile, and applications. As a software engineer at Google, you'll be part of developing next-generation technologies that impact billions of users worldwide. The role involves working on critical projects with opportunities for growth and team rotation as the business evolves.

You'll be working on products that provide enterprises and end users the ability to manage services at scale - from apps to TVs, laptops to phones. The position requires versatility in full-stack development and enthusiasm for tackling new challenges. As part of a small and dynamic team, you'll be involved in designing, testing, deploying, and maintaining software solutions.

The ideal candidate should have a strong foundation in computer science fundamentals and programming experience. Google offers a collaborative environment where you'll work alongside talented engineers, with opportunities to contribute to innovative projects that have global impact. The role combines technical expertise with project management skills, requiring both coding proficiency and the ability to manage deliverables effectively.

This position is perfect for recent graduates or early-career professionals looking to launch their careers at one of the world's leading technology companies. Google provides a supportive environment for professional growth, with exposure to cutting-edge technologies and complex technical challenges. The company's commitment to innovation and technical excellence makes this an ideal opportunity for those seeking to make a significant impact in software engineering.

Last updated 2 months ago

Responsibilities For Software Engineer, Early Career, Start 2025

  • Design, develop, test, deploy, maintain, and improve software
  • Manage project priorities, deadlines, and deliverables
  • Take on tasks as requested following through to completion despite roadblocks or distractions
  • Comply with all company health and safety policies, procedures, and legal requirements

Requirements For Software Engineer, Early Career, Start 2025

Python
Java
JavaScript
  • Bachelor's degree in Computer Science or related technical field, or equivalent practical experience
  • Exper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ript)
  • Experience working with data structures or algorithms during coursework/projects, research, internships, or practical experience in school or work